However, when it comes to downgrading, it’s not that straightforward and your options will vary depending on the version that your currently on (i.e. downgrading Turbotax Premier to Deluxe). Let’s take a look at your choices when moving to a lower priced version of TurboTax.
How to Downgrade Turbotax Online Products.
If you’ve started on the wrong version of TurboTax Online, for example on the Premier version when you actually needed the Deluxe version, then you’ll have to use the “Clear and Start over” feature. The good news though is that the start over option will not delete your TurboTax account (i.e. your login, password, etc.) and will not affect your prior year returns. Only the information that you entered for this year will be deleted. There is unfortunately no way of downgrading without beginning from scratch again which probably won’t make you very happy, especially if your near completing your tax return. That means that you’ll need to re-enter all of your W2 forms, investments, and all your other tax info again.
To find the start over link, just login to your online TurboTax account and navigate to the “My Account” tab. There you’ll see the option to “Clear & Start Over”. After you confirm the selection, you’ll be taken back to the beginning of your tax return where you can re-enter your 2018 tax-year data.
It’s just important to note that you’ll only be able to start over with a lower version on TurboTax online if you haven’t yet paid for your TurboTax purchase. If you’ve already paid and filed your tax return, there is now no way to go back and Intuit is firm in not providing refunds for the difference between the version that you paid for and the lower one that you actually needed.

How to Downgrade Turbotax Desktop/Download Products.
If you’ve purchased the desktop/download version of TurboTax Deluxe, Premier, or Home & Business, either at Intuit directly or at a traditional reseller like Amazon, then this is where things get difficult. That’s because there’s no option to downgrade and Intuit will not issue any partial refunds for any differences between the version you bought and the one that you actually need.
But all is not lost! Intuit has a pretty good return policy and regardless where you bought your desktop/CD copy of the software, you’ll be able to return it directly to Intuit for a full refund. That includes purchases from stores like Best Buy that do not accept returns on open-box software. So just pack up your purchase, scan your receipt and send it back to them using these steps.
After you send your software in for a refund, just repurchase the version that you need and reinstall the new software on your PC or Mac (you’ll be able to see all our current TurboTax discounts to help you eve on your new purchase). Just make sure to delete your old TurboTax software first before installing your new one.
